    Internet Explorer

    I hope the computer expert members can advice me on this. I have found, since today,that I am unable to open Internet Explorer. I keep on getting the message that "IE is not responding" and keeps on opening and closing all the time. I tried to download another IE but I get the message "do you wish to save it" and nothing about Run ,continuing or download etc etc.
    I don't know whether other members have experienced IE problems today?

    I am able to access my e-mails etc via windows mail and also by using the Firefox brower by entering my internet/e-mail provider's name on the search box.

              #7
              Re: Internet Explorer

              its in control panel add remove programs and on the left hand side turn windows features on and off

              but you cant fully uninstall it as its so closely integrated into windows that its a part of the operating system
